The Bail Bond Agreement serves as a legal contract between the applicant and the bail bonding company in California, detailing the responsibilities and obligations involved in securing a bail bond for a defendant. This form is essential for users such as attorneys, partners, owners, associates, paralegals, and legal assistants, who can utilize it to facilitate the bail bonding process. Key features of the form include provisions for premium payments, indemnification clauses, and cooperation requirements for securing the defendant’s release. Users must fill out the form accurately, including personal information, bond amounts, and court details, ensuring all statements made are true. Editing the form requires clear communication of any updates, particularly changes in contact information, to avoid further complications. The form also outlines financial liabilities, including attorney's fees and indemnity for any expenses incurred if the defendant needs to be returned to custody. If a defendant cannot afford bail, then at the arraignment or any hearing while still incarcerated the defendant can request a bail reduction or release without bail. That must be supported with evidence that the defendant is unlikely to reoffend or to flee.

To conduct business as a bail agent, the professional must receive licensing from the California Department of Insurance. To obtain licensing, he or she must acquire a California bond of bail agent.

The bail bond agent will need you to sign some paperwork in order for you to secure their services. This usually means paying an amount to the agent, usually a percentage of the total bail amount, and signing off on any collateral for the bond.
